Chad Kooiman: Building a Car Shop People Actually Love

In this episode, I sit down with Chad Kooiman, founder of Ultimate Automotive, to trace his journey from a small franchise shop to a thriving two-location business built on culture, trust, and community. Chad shares how he started in 2000 under the All Tune and Lube franchise while still in college, hustling for customers through coupons before eventually breaking out on his own. We dig into his people-first philosophy — how he takes care of his team, runs the business alongside his wife, and has evolved from technician to CEO. He also walks me through what makes Ultimate Automotive different: a free ride service for customers, an unconventional pay structure, and a culture of curiosity that's getting his team ready for EVs and self-driving vehicles.
